Choosing the Right Pine Furniture
Pine furniture can look great in any home.
It tends to go well with pretty much any colour scheme and has a timeless quality.
That probably explains why so many home owners look to buy this type of furniture.
You may even have considered it yourself.
But it's important that you buy the right products.
If you do, you can get a great new look in your home and can get some pieces that are really built to last.
If you make the wrong buying decisions, however, then you could be making a costly mistake.
So let's begin by talking about the importance of looking at the quality of any items that you're intending to buy.
Quality is so important because really good quality furniture should last you for years.
Poorly manufactured alternatives, on the other hand, may only last for a matter of months.
So how do you spot whether a piece of furniture will be good enough for your needs? Some people decide that more expensive items will be of a higher quality, but that's not always the case.
You shouldn't assume that an expensive coffee table, for instance, will automatically be built to a higher quality.
If you do see a really cheap item of furniture, however, you might want to ask a few questions before making a purchase.
A dining table made from solid wood simply won't be cheap.
That means that cheaper alternatives are unlikely to be using solid wood.
When you're looking at furniture, don't be afraid to ask questions.
There's no harm at all in ensuring that you know exactly what you're looking at.
In fact, it could really be a false economy if you take any other approach to making your purchase.
